Key Responsibilities:

The Associate Analyst of IT Communications is responsible for a range of communications for the Digital Technology org. This includes but is not limited to writing newsletter articles, tracking engagement metrics, creating newsletter graphics, brainstorming creative communication content and producing internal videos. The ideal candidate will thrive in a culture of ownership, delivery and innovation. You are a great communicator with prior experience in communication, social media or marketing. You have a strong attention to detail and process and enjoy building relationships across the organization to drive efficiency.

+ Work with leaders and DT partners to craft stories that highlight innovation, teamwork, and efficiency across the department to promote in the digital technology newsletter

+ Write stories, create graphics and produce videos for email, blog articles and video series

+ Partner with Corporate Communications to promote digital technology accomplishments and news to the appropriate internal and external channels

Qualifications

What’s needed to succeed (Minimum Qualifications):

+ Bachelor’s degree from an accredited college/university

+ 2+ years in communications-related experience

+ Communications

+ Outstanding writing skills with a passion for communications

+ Experience crafting compelling stories and demonstrated experience crafting a customer/product story, or a corporate announcement

+ Self starter with ability to work cross-functionally and cross-departmentally

+ Basic graphic design and video editing skills

+ Must be legally authorized to work in the United States for any employer without sponsorship

+ Successful completion of interview required to meet job qualification

+ Reliable, punctual attendance is an essential function of the position

What will help you propel from the pack (Preferred Qualifications):

+ Bachelor’s degree in communications, or related field

+ Marketing, Social Media

+ Graphic Design, Video editing and production
